Analysis

The most recent figure for out-of-school rate for adolescents of lower secondary school age, male in Qatar is 7.1%, measured in 2024.

The figure is down 10.4% on the previous year and down 3.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, out-of-school rate for adolescents of lower secondary school age, male in Qatar peaked at 43.3% in 1980 and was at its lowest, 0.9%, in 2017.

That places Qatar 86th out of 162 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
